xref: /haiku/src/tests/kits/app/bhandler/NextHandlerTest.h (revision 52a380120846174213ccce9c4aab0dda17c72083)
1*52a38012Sejakowatz //------------------------------------------------------------------------------
2*52a38012Sejakowatz //	NextHandlerTest.h
3*52a38012Sejakowatz //
4*52a38012Sejakowatz //------------------------------------------------------------------------------
5*52a38012Sejakowatz 
6*52a38012Sejakowatz #ifndef NEXTHANDLERTEST_H
7*52a38012Sejakowatz #define NEXTHANDLERTEST_H
8*52a38012Sejakowatz 
9*52a38012Sejakowatz // Standard Includes -----------------------------------------------------------
10*52a38012Sejakowatz 
11*52a38012Sejakowatz // System Includes -------------------------------------------------------------
12*52a38012Sejakowatz #if defined(TEST_R5)
13*52a38012Sejakowatz #include <be/app/Handler.h>
14*52a38012Sejakowatz #else
15*52a38012Sejakowatz #include <Handler.h>
16*52a38012Sejakowatz #endif
17*52a38012Sejakowatz 
18*52a38012Sejakowatz // Project Includes ------------------------------------------------------------
19*52a38012Sejakowatz 
20*52a38012Sejakowatz // Local Includes --------------------------------------------------------------
21*52a38012Sejakowatz #include "../common.h"
22*52a38012Sejakowatz 
23*52a38012Sejakowatz // Local Defines ---------------------------------------------------------------
24*52a38012Sejakowatz 
25*52a38012Sejakowatz // Globals ---------------------------------------------------------------------
26*52a38012Sejakowatz 
27*52a38012Sejakowatz class TNextHandlerTest : public TestCase
28*52a38012Sejakowatz {
29*52a38012Sejakowatz 	public:
30*52a38012Sejakowatz 		TNextHandlerTest() {;}
31*52a38012Sejakowatz 		TNextHandlerTest(std::string name) : TestCase(name) {;}
32*52a38012Sejakowatz 
33*52a38012Sejakowatz 		void NextHandler1();
34*52a38012Sejakowatz 		void NextHandler2();
35*52a38012Sejakowatz 
36*52a38012Sejakowatz 		static Test* Suite();
37*52a38012Sejakowatz 
38*52a38012Sejakowatz 	private:
39*52a38012Sejakowatz 		BHandler	fHandler;
40*52a38012Sejakowatz };
41*52a38012Sejakowatz 
42*52a38012Sejakowatz #endif	//NEXTHANDLERTEST_H
43*52a38012Sejakowatz 
44*52a38012Sejakowatz /*
45*52a38012Sejakowatz  * $Log $
46*52a38012Sejakowatz  *
47*52a38012Sejakowatz  * $Id  $
48*52a38012Sejakowatz  *
49*52a38012Sejakowatz  */
50*52a38012Sejakowatz 
51